About

G Kumaresan is a scholar working on Agronomy and Crop Science, Food Science and Small Animals. According to data from OpenAlex, G Kumaresan has authored 58 papers receiving a total of 314 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Agronomy and Crop Science, 12 papers in Food Science and 12 papers in Small Animals. Recurrent topics in G Kumaresan’s work include Probiotics and Fermented Foods (8 papers), Brucella: diagnosis, epidemiology, treatment (7 papers) and Clostridium difficile and Clostridium perfringens research (6 papers). G Kumaresan is often cited by papers focused on Probiotics and Fermented Foods (8 papers), Brucella: diagnosis, epidemiology, treatment (7 papers) and Clostridium difficile and Clostridium perfringens research (6 papers). G Kumaresan collaborates with scholars based in India and Oman. G Kumaresan's co-authors include Anil Kumar Mishra, C. P. Gnanamuthu, T. Jacob John, Vaskar Saha, Deepak Sharma, A. Elango, Vijay Kumar, Davinder Singh, S.D. Kharche and P. S. Banerjee and has published in prestigious journals such as Archives of Microbiology, Journal of Food Composition and Analysis and Epidemiology and Infection.
